Job description

Validation & Engineering Group, Inc. (V&EG) a Pinnaql company is a leading services supplier who provides solutions for the Pharmaceutical, Biotechnology, Chemical, Food, and Medical Devices industries in the following areas: Laboratory, Compliance, Computer, Engineering, Project Management, Validation, and other services.
We are seeking a talented, dedicated individual committed to work under the highest ethics standards for the following position:
  • Sr Engineer

Description:
Independently provides and/or directs the characterization of process optimization strategies and/or troubleshooting of operational issues in the operations, manufacturing, pilot plant or capital projects environment. Applies advanced and diverse engineering principles to the design and implementation of major system modifications, experiments, process and/or capital projects. Develops, organizes, analyzes and presents interpretation of results for operational issues or engineering projects of significant scope and complexity.
Qualifications:
  • Engineer with years of experience, preferably in aseptic processing environments, including Fill/Finish operations such as vial and syringe filling lines.
  • Experience in characterization activities and performance qualification (PQ) for New Product Introductions (NPI).
  • Minimum of 4 years of experience in direct pharmaceutical, medical device or biotechnology industries.
  • Experience in direct process / manufacturing areas.
  • Must be fully bilingual (English / Spanish) with excellent oral skills.
  • Must be proficient using MS Windows and Microsoft Office applications.
  • Strong knowledge in cGxP and regulatory guidance as well as understanding of how they are applied to regulatory compliance.
  • Experience in Design Documentation (URS, DS), IQ, OQ, PQ protocols development and execution, deviations and reports generation.
  • SDLC, Risk Assessment, Data Integrity, Factory Acceptance Test (FAT) & Site Acceptance Test (SAT).
  • Available to work extended hours, possibility of weekends and holidays.

Education:
  • Masters + 2 years of Engineering experience OR Bachelors in Engineering + 4 years of Engineering experience. Preferred: Mechanical or Chemical Engineering

Competencies/Skills:
  • Working knowledge of pharmaceutical/biotech processes
  • Familiarity with validation processes
  • Familiarity with documentation in a highly regulated environment
  • Ability to operate specialized laboratory equipment and computers as appropriate.
  • Ability to interpret and apply GLPs and GMPs.
  • Ability to apply engineering science to production.
  • Able to develop solutions to routine technical problems of limited scope
  • Comprehensive understanding of validation protocol execution requirements.
